Demetre II (825-861). Demetre II actively fought against the Byzantine influence in western Georgia. thrice defeated the Byzantine army. Located in western Georgia Diocese obey the Patriarch of Constantinople. Thanks to the great efforts of the kings Egrissko-Abkhazian kingdom at the turn of the IX-X centuries the diocese of western Georgia, obeyed Mtskheta Catholicos. This was a significant event: a prerequisite for the political unification of Georgia was a church reunification. This process began Demeter. Demeter had fought against the Arab commander of the Bug-Turk, when he invaded the eastern Georgia. But was defeated and retreated into western Georgia.
